What does a SAP ERP Implementation Manager do?
Career: Sap Erp Implementation Manager
A SAP ERP Implementation Manager oversees the planning, execution, and completion of SAP ERP software projects within an organization. They coordinate between stakeholders, manage project timelines and budgets, and ensure that the implementation meets business requirements. Their role includes troubleshooting issues, managing project teams, and facilitating user training to ensure successful adoption of the new system. Ultimately, they are responsible for delivering a smooth transition to SAP ERP and maximizing its benefits for the business.
